Daily Tech History: September 6, 2012 — Facebook Officially Closes the Instagram Deal

Person taking a photo with a smartphone, evoking mobile photo-sharing apps like Instagram

On September 6, 2012, Facebook officially closed its acquisition of Instagram, turning a deal first struck in a late-night handshake five months earlier into reality. The purchase was announced back in April 2012 at roughly $1 billion, split between cash and Facebook stock, but by the time the paperwork was finalized the value had slipped to somewhere around $736 million — Facebook’s own stock had taken a beating since its bumpy IPO that May, and a big chunk of the deal was paid in shares.

At the time, Instagram was a two-year-old startup with a headcount you could count on two hands and zero revenue, which made a billion-dollar price tag look reckless to a lot of observers. It didn’t look that way for long. Instagram went on to become one of the most valuable acquisitions in tech history, now anchoring a massive share of Meta’s advertising business and counting well over a billion users worldwide. Closing the deal also meant clearing regulatory review from the FTC and California’s Department of Corporations, both of which signed off in the weeks beforehand.

Also notable: Instagram marked the closing by announcing it had just crossed 5 billion photos shared on the platform — a number the app now blows past in a single day.

Daily Tech History: September 5, 1977 — Voyager 1 Launches on Its Grand Tour

Artist's rendering of a deep space probe, evoking the Voyager 1 spacecraft

On September 5, 1977, NASA launched Voyager 1 from Cape Canaveral atop a Titan IIIE-Centaur rocket, sending the spacecraft on a mission to fly past Jupiter and Saturn. Oddly enough, Voyager 1 lifted off two weeks after its twin, Voyager 2, but its faster trajectory let it overtake its sibling by mid-December of that same year — a reminder that in space travel, launch order doesn’t always decide who arrives first.

The probe delivered on its original assignment and then some, spotting two previously unknown Jovian moons and a faint ring around Jupiter, then turning up five new moons and a distinct ring at Saturn. But Voyager 1’s real legacy is what happened after the planetary flybys ended. Rather than being switched off, it kept flying outward, and on February 17, 1998, it passed Pioneer 10 to become the most distant human-made object in existence. In August 2012, it pushed through the heliopause and became the first spacecraft to reach interstellar space, crossing out of the bubble of charged particles the Sun blows around our solar system.

Nearly five decades later, Voyager 1 is still checking in. Now more than 164 astronomical units from Earth (over 15 billion miles), it communicates with NASA’s Deep Space Network using a handful of surviving instruments, after engineers have carefully powered down others to stretch its dwindling energy supply for as long as possible. It’s a strange kind of longevity for 1970s-era hardware: the plutonium is fading, but the signal keeps coming.

Also worth noting: Voyager 1’s twin, Voyager 2, gets its own turn in this series — it launched August 20, 1977, and remains the only spacecraft to have visited all four giant planets.

Daily Tech History: September 4, 1998 — Google Is Officially Incorporated

Google's headquarters building with the company's colorful logo

On September 4, 1998, Larry Page and Sergey Brin filed the paperwork to incorporate Google Inc., turning a Stanford PhD side project into a company. The two had met a few years earlier when Brin, already a grad student, gave campus tours to prospective students like Page. Their shared interest in extracting patterns from huge, messy datasets led them to a search engine they first called BackRub, built around the idea of ranking web pages by how many other pages linked to them.

By 1997 they’d renamed the project Google, a nod to “googol,” the mathematical term for a 1 followed by 100 zeros — a fittingly oversized name for a company whose stated mission was to organize all of the world’s information. The incorporation in September 1998 made it official, and the fledgling company set up shop in a Menlo Park garage. It didn’t take long for the outside world to notice: by December of that same year, PC Magazine had already named Google one of its “Top 100 Web Sites” for 1998, a remarkably fast turnaround for a company barely three months old.

What started as two grad students’ research project became the dominant way most of the world finds information online, and eventually the anchor of Alphabet, one of the largest companies on the planet. It’s a reminder that some of tech’s biggest empires started as unglamorous, unfunded experiments in a university lab.

Also on this day: September 4 has a habit of showing up in tech history — in 1888, George Eastman registered the “Kodak” trademark and patented his roll-film camera, kicking off the era of consumer photography.

Daily Tech History: September 3, 1995 — eBay Is Born as “AuctionWeb”

A vintage CRT computer monitor, evoking the mid-1990s era when eBay launched as AuctionWeb

On September 3, 1995, programmer Pierre Omidyar launched a scrappy little auction site out of his San Jose apartment called AuctionWeb — the site that would eventually become eBay. It was one of several experimental pages on Omidyar’s personal website, built over a Labor Day weekend as a side project to test whether a fair, open marketplace could work online. The very first item listed and sold was, fittingly, something nobody actually needed: a broken laser pointer, which went for $14.83. When Omidyar reached out to make sure the winning bidder understood the pointer didn’t work, he got a reply that has become tech folklore: “I’m a collector of broken laser pointers.”

What made AuctionWeb different wasn’t the idea of an auction — it was the feedback system. Letting buyers and sellers rate each other gave strangers a reason to trust one another with money, sight unseen, which turned out to be the missing piece for consumer-to-consumer commerce on the internet. The site made $1,000 in its first month, more than enough to cover Omidyar’s hosting bill, and kept climbing from there. It wasn’t renamed eBay until 1997 — a shortened nod to Omidyar’s consulting firm, Echo Bay Technology Group — but the DNA of the marketplace, strangers trading directly with strangers, was there from day one.

Also worth noting on this date: September 3, 1996 saw the public launch of Hotmail, one of the first free webmail services, which helped normalize the idea of checking your email from any browser rather than a single home computer.

Daily Tech History: September 2, 1936 — Andrew Grove, the Man Who Built Intel, Is Born

Macro photograph of a black semiconductor circuit board, representing Intel's chip technology

On September 2, 1936, Andrew Grove was born in Budapest, Hungary — a birth that, decades later, would matter enormously to the technology industry. Born Gróf András István, he survived Nazi occupation as a child and fled Hungary alone at age 20 during the 1956 revolution, arriving in the United States with almost nothing. Within a decade he’d become one of Silicon Valley’s most consequential executives.

Grove joined Intel on the day it was founded in 1968 as employee number three, working alongside legends Robert Noyce and Gordon Moore. He became CEO in 1987 and spent the next decade transforming Intel from a struggling memory-chip maker into the dominant force behind the personal computer’s processor. Under his leadership, Intel’s market value grew from roughly $4 billion to $197 billion. Grove’s management philosophy, distilled in his famous line “Only the paranoid survive,” pushed the idea that companies must constantly watch for “strategic inflection points” — moments of fundamental change that can make or break a business if leaders don’t act fast enough. He’s also credited with popularizing the OKR (Objectives and Key Results) goal-setting framework, which Intel used internally and which later became a cornerstone of how Google — and countless startups since — sets and tracks goals.

Also worth noting: Grove’s influence was recognized well beyond the chip industry. In 1997, Time magazine named him Person of the Year, crediting him as “the person most responsible for the amazing growth in the power and the innovative potential of microchips.” It’s a reminder that the hardware powering every device we use today has a very human history behind it.

Daily Tech History: September 2, 1993 — W3Catalog, the Web’s First Search Engine, Goes Live

A vintage iMac computer from the early web era

On September 2, 1993, Oscar Nierstrasz at the University of Geneva launched W3Catalog, widely considered the first search engine for the World Wide Web. This was still the web’s very early days, barely two years after Tim Berners-Lee had put the first website online, and there was no Google, no Yahoo, not even a way to search the growing pile of pages beyond browsing hand-curated lists.

W3Catalog’s approach was clever rather than technically heroic: instead of crawling the web itself (a technique that didn’t really exist yet), it took several already-popular, manually maintained directories of web resources, mirrored them, and reformatted their entries into one searchable database. A Perl-based front end, built as an extension to an early web server since CGI scripting didn’t exist yet either, let visitors actually query that combined list. It wasn’t glamorous, but it worked, and it proved that “searching the web” could be a standalone service rather than something users did by clicking through bookmark pages. W3Catalog stayed online until 1996, by which point crawler-based engines like WebCrawler and Lycos had made its approach obsolete.

Also on this day: September 2, 1969 marked the very first ARPANET equipment installation at UCLA, the network that would eventually grow into the internet W3Catalog was built to search.

Daily Tech History: September 1, 1979 — Pioneer 11 Becomes First Spacecraft to Fly By Saturn

The planet Saturn and its rings as seen from space

On September 1, 1979, NASA’s Pioneer 11 spacecraft became the first human-made object to fly past Saturn, skimming within about 13,000 miles of the planet’s cloud tops at roughly 71,000 miles per hour. Launched all the way back in 1973 primarily to scout a safe path through the outer solar system for the more sophisticated Voyager probes that would follow, Pioneer 11 had already buzzed Jupiter in 1974 before spending years coasting toward its Saturn encounter.

The flyby wasn’t just a first-contact milestone, it delivered real science. Pioneer 11 detected Saturn’s bow shock the day before closest approach, giving scientists their first solid evidence of the planet’s magnetic field, and its instruments spotted a previously unknown ring (later named the F ring) along with two additional moons. Because Pioneer 11 was essentially flying blind through territory no one had mapped, its data on Saturn’s ring plane and radiation environment was critical for planning safe, close passes for Voyager 1 and Voyager 2 less than a year later. In a sense, this humble, golf-cart-speed probe took the risk so its more famous successors didn’t have to.

Also on this day: September 1, 1994 saw the Library of Congress launch an early “virtual library” initiative, one of the first major efforts by a national cultural institution to put its collections online, a small but telling sign of the internet’s shift from research curiosity to public infrastructure.

Daily Tech History: August 31, 1994 — Adobe Finalizes Its Merger With Aldus

Design books and paper layout samples, evoking early desktop publishing and page design

On August 31, 1994, Adobe Systems officially closed its acquisition of Aldus Corporation, the Seattle software company behind PageMaker — the program widely credited with kicking off desktop publishing a decade earlier. The deal, valued at roughly $446 million, brought PageMaker’s user base under Adobe’s roof and folded one of publishing software’s pioneering names into the company that made PostScript.

Aldus was founded in 1984 by Paul Brainerd, who is credited with coining the term “desktop publishing” itself. PageMaker, released in 1985, paired with Apple’s LaserWriter and Adobe’s PostScript language to let ordinary Macintosh users lay out newsletters and books the way only professional typesetters could before. That combination is often cited as the reason the early Mac found a real foothold in offices and print shops. By merging with Adobe a decade later, Aldus effectively handed its flagship product to the company that would eventually build a rival layout tool, InDesign, and retire PageMaker altogether in 2001.

The merger is a reminder that even category-defining software has a shelf life: PageMaker had already started losing ground to QuarkXPress by the time Adobe absorbed it, and it took Adobe five more years to ship a true successor. Still, the DNA of that original desktop publishing breakthrough lives on in InDesign, which remains a standard tool in publishing and design studios today.

Daily Tech History: August 30, 1969 — The First IMP Arrives at UCLA, Launching the ARPANET

A rack of networking servers, evoking the early network hardware of the ARPANET era

On August 30, 1969, the very first piece of internet hardware landed at UCLA. Bolt Beranek and Newman (BBN) shipped the first Interface Message Processor — a modified Honeywell DDP-516 minicomputer with a mere 12K of memory — to Leonard Kleinrock’s Network Measurements Center. It arrived two days ahead of schedule, and a small team of graduate students, including Vinton Cerf, Steve Crocker, and Jon Postel, got to work installing it. That box became the first node of the ARPANET, the Pentagon-funded research network that would eventually grow into the internet we use today.

The IMP’s job was deceptively simple but hugely consequential: it acted as a dedicated gateway, taking data from a host computer and breaking it into packets to send across the network, laying the groundwork for the packet-switching approach that still underpins how data moves online. A second IMP reached Stanford Research Institute about a month later, and on October 29, 1969, the two machines exchanged the first message ever sent between networked computers — an attempted “LOGIN” that crashed after the first two letters, “LO,” were transmitted. Modest beginnings for what became a global network connecting billions of devices.

Also notable on this day: August 30, 1907 is the birthday of John Mauchly, the physicist who, with J. Presper Eckert, built ENIAC — the first large-scale electronic computer — a couple of decades before that first IMP ever booted up.

Daily Tech History: August 29, 1990 — The UK’s Computer Misuse Act Takes Effect

Vintage 1990s-era computer, evoking the era of the UK's Computer Misuse Act

On August 29, 1990, the United Kingdom’s Computer Misuse Act came into force, becoming one of the first laws anywhere in the world written specifically to criminalize hacking. It had received Royal Assent two months earlier, on June 29, but this was the day it actually took effect and started governing what counted as a computer crime.

The law existed because of an embarrassing gap earlier in the decade. In 1984, two hackers, Robert Schifreen and Stephen Gold, talked their way into British Telecom’s Prestel network — at one point even poking around in the private mailbox of Prince Philip, the Duke of Edinburgh. When they were eventually caught and prosecuted, the case (R v Gold & Schifreen) fell apart on appeal, because Britain simply had no law that treated unauthorized computer access as a crime; prosecutors had tried to stretch old forgery statutes to fit, and the House of Lords wasn’t buying it. Parliament responded with the Computer Misuse Act, which created three specific offenses: unauthorized access to computer material, unauthorized access with intent to commit a further crime, and unauthorized modification of computer material.

More than three decades later, the Act is still on the books and still the primary UK statute prosecutors reach for in hacking cases, though it’s been amended over the years and remains a point of debate — security researchers have long argued its broad wording makes it risky to do legitimate penetration testing or vulnerability disclosure without careful legal footing. Love it or criticize it, it set an early template that plenty of other countries’ computer crime laws would later echo.
